EdifactProtocolSettings Constructor

Definition

Initializes a new instance of EdifactProtocolSettings.

public EdifactProtocolSettings (Azure.ResourceManager.Logic.Models.EdifactValidationSettings validationSettings, Azure.ResourceManager.Logic.Models.EdifactFramingSettings framingSettings, Azure.ResourceManager.Logic.Models.EdifactEnvelopeSettings envelopeSettings, Azure.ResourceManager.Logic.Models.EdifactAcknowledgementSettings acknowledgementSettings, Azure.ResourceManager.Logic.Models.EdifactMessageFilter messageFilter, Azure.ResourceManager.Logic.Models.EdifactProcessingSettings processingSettings, System.Collections.Generic.IEnumerable<Azure.ResourceManager.Logic.Models.EdifactSchemaReference> schemaReferences);
new Azure.ResourceManager.Logic.Models.EdifactProtocolSettings : Azure.ResourceManager.Logic.Models.EdifactValidationSettings * Azure.ResourceManager.Logic.Models.EdifactFramingSettings * Azure.ResourceManager.Logic.Models.EdifactEnvelopeSettings * Azure.ResourceManager.Logic.Models.EdifactAcknowledgementSettings * Azure.ResourceManager.Logic.Models.EdifactMessageFilter * Azure.ResourceManager.Logic.Models.EdifactProcessingSettings * seq<Azure.ResourceManager.Logic.Models.EdifactSchemaReference> -> Azure.ResourceManager.Logic.Models.EdifactProtocolSettings
Public Sub New (validationSettings As EdifactValidationSettings, framingSettings As EdifactFramingSettings, envelopeSettings As EdifactEnvelopeSettings, acknowledgementSettings As EdifactAcknowledgementSettings, messageFilter As EdifactMessageFilter, processingSettings As EdifactProcessingSettings, schemaReferences As IEnumerable(Of EdifactSchemaReference))

Parameters

validationSettings
EdifactValidationSettings

The EDIFACT validation settings.

framingSettings
EdifactFramingSettings

The EDIFACT framing settings.

envelopeSettings
EdifactEnvelopeSettings

The EDIFACT envelope settings.

acknowledgementSettings
EdifactAcknowledgementSettings

The EDIFACT acknowledgement settings.

messageFilter
EdifactMessageFilter

The EDIFACT message filter.

processingSettings
EdifactProcessingSettings

The EDIFACT processing Settings.

schemaReferences
IEnumerable<EdifactSchemaReference>

The EDIFACT schema references.

Exceptions

validationSettings, framingSettings, envelopeSettings, acknowledgementSettings, messageFilter, processingSettings or schemaReferences is null.

Applies to